However, if this is your daily routine, it may be a little too much . Here’s how this lazy kangaroo spends his days. All of you, meet Rufus, the most spoilt joey in the world.

Rufus’s life was not always like this when he was over four years old. The kangaroo was rescued at the age of eight months and was found in the Patch Kangaroo Sanctuary in Boston, South Australia.

Fortunately, in Kim Haywood and her husband Neil, the sanctuary administrators, he received all the love and comfort he needed.

As the “compassionate couple” and the rescued kangaroo developed strong ties, Kim and Neil chose to keep Rufus in their home. Now he behaves as if he owns a house, or at least a sofa.

Rufus enjoys his days relaxing on the soft couch, cuddling with his father.
However, Neil and Kim soon realized that the sofa might not be large enough to accommodate them all.

Rufus, on the other hand, wants it all for himself, and sometimes for his father. Because he sometimes begs Nil to rub his belly, which Nil does happily.

“When he first started doing it, we thought it was the sweetest thing ever,” Kim continued “He sleeps fast because he knows it will be safe there, he does not mind watching a little TV.”
